The Spotlight on Yotel San Francisco

Modern, Futuristic Comfort Steps from San Francisco’s Top Stages

YOTEL San Francisco blends sleek, tech-savvy design with unbeatable access to the city's best concert venues. Located on Market Street in the heart of downtown, it’s just a short walk to The Warfield and SHN Golden Gate Theater—and under a mile to the legendary Bill Graham Civic Auditorium and Moscone Center. With minimalist rooms, free WiFi, and a cool, urban vibe, this hotel is tailor-made for travelers chasing live music and city energy.

Why Concert-goers love it

Just a 4-minute walk to two of San Francisco’s most iconic music venues, YOTEL San Francisco lets you skip the rideshare chaos and stroll to your show. The hotel’s central location also means easy access to late-night MUNI and BART lines, and its 24-hour front desk is perfect for post-show arrivals. Rooms are well insulated, offering a surprisingly quiet environment for a good night’s sleep—even in this lively neighborhood. Flexible check-in at 3:00 PM and check-out at 11:00 AM gives you time to sleep in after rocking out.

Food and Drink Options

The hotel features a restaurant on-site, ideal for a quick bite before heading out. While there's no 24/7 room service, you’ll find plenty of walkable late-night eats nearby along Market Street and in the Tenderloin and SoMa neighborhoods. Breakfast is available downstairs and nearby cafés make it easy to refuel after a late night.

Nightlife Options

While YOTEL itself doesn’t have a live music bar, you’re just steps from some of San Francisco’s best nightlife. From dive bars to stylish lounges, the area around Union Square and Mid-Market has you covered. Prefer something more low-key? Chill out with a drink at nearby rooftop spots or check out hotel-adjacent bars for local craft brews.

What People Say

Guests love the hotel’s location—it’s often described as “perfect for concerts” and “super convenient for nightlife.” Reviews on Booking.com and TripAdvisor highlight the clean, modern rooms and the friendly, efficient staff. The tech-forward design and affordability are also big wins for travelers looking for style without the splurge.

Areas for Improvement

The rooms are on the smaller side, especially if you're traveling with gear or extra luggage, and some guests note the surrounding neighborhood can feel a bit gritty at night—though most say it’s manageable and typical for a downtown city stay. There's no on-site parking, so plan ahead if you're driving.

The Bottom Line

If you're catching a show in downtown San Francisco and want a smart, stylish, and walkable base—YOTEL San Francisco hits all the right notes.
